Last night, the Dolphin Discovery Trail 2025 culminated in a spectacular charity auction at the Peninsula Hotel, raising over £40,000 on the night and more than £80,000 in total for Autism Guernsey and the GSPCA.

Every year we hear of firework related incidents involving animals and children. While fireworks may be exciting and pretty to look at and its fun to celebrate many celebrations with a bang, we must put our safety, the safety of our pets and the local wildlife first. 

Saturday 22nd April from 2130hours at the Peninsula Hotel there is a private firework display planned so please ensure your animals are safe and prepare for the unusual sounds and sights they might be subjected too.
